What is the GOOLOO GT3000 Jump Starter?

The GOOLOO GT3000 Jump Starter is a portable lithium-ion battery pack designed to jump-start vehicles with dead or weak 12V batteries. Unlike traditional jumper cables that require another vehicle, this self-contained unit lets you revive your car solo—no waiting for help or calling roadside assistance. It’s engineered for reliability, speed, and safety, making it ideal for drivers who value independence and preparedness.

This jump starter is built around a high-capacity lithium battery that delivers a peak current of 3000 amps, enough to start most gas and diesel engines with ease. It’s compatible with vehicles up to 8.5 liters in gas engine displacement and 6.0 liters in diesel, covering everything from compact cars like a Honda Civic to larger SUVs like a Toyota Highlander or Ford F-150. The device weighs just 1.32 pounds (about 600 grams), making it lighter than a laptop and small enough to store in your glove compartment, trunk, or camping gear.

Beyond jump-starting, the GT3000 doubles as a 65W USB-C power bank with two-way fast charging. That means it not only charges your devices quickly but also recharges itself in under an hour using a compatible 65W PD charger. It also includes a bright LED flashlight with multiple modes—steady, SOS, and strobe—perfect for nighttime breakdowns or outdoor adventures. The entire system is protected by a 10-layer Battery Management System (BMS) that guards against short circuits, reverse polarity, overcurrent, overcharging, and overheating.

Included in the box are the jump starter unit, smart jumper cables with built-in safety indicators, a USB-A to USB-C cable, a USB-C to USB-C cable, and a detailed user manual. GOOLOO also backs the product with an 18-month warranty, which is a strong sign of confidence in its durability and performance.

Supersafe System with 10-Layer Protection

Safety is a top concern when dealing with high-current devices, and the GOOLOO GT3000 Jump Starter addresses this with a comprehensive Supersafe System. This advanced Battery Management System (BMS) includes 10 layers of protection to ensure safe and stable operation every time you use it.

The protection layers include: short circuit protection, reverse polarity protection, overcurrent protection, overcharge protection, over-discharge protection, overvoltage protection, undervoltage protection, temperature protection, cell balancing, and spark-proof technology. In practical terms, this means the device will shut down automatically if it detects a dangerous condition—like connecting the cables backward or a sudden surge in current.

I tested the reverse polarity protection by intentionally connecting the clamps incorrectly. The jump starter immediately displayed a red warning light and emitted a beep, preventing any damage to the unit or the vehicle. Once I corrected the connection, it worked flawlessly. This kind of fail-safe mechanism is essential for users who may not be mechanically inclined or who are using a jump starter in stressful situations.

The temperature protection is another critical feature. I used the GT3000 in both freezing (-2°C / 28°F) and hot (38°C / 100°F) conditions, and it performed consistently without overheating or shutting down. The internal sensors monitor temperature in real time and adjust output accordingly, ensuring safe operation in extreme environments.

Frequently Asked Questions

GOOLOO GT3000 Jump Starter & GT4000S Jump Starter - Additional View

Q: Can the GOOLOO GT3000 jump-start a diesel truck?
A: Yes, it supports diesel engines up to 6.0L, including most light-duty trucks like the Ford F-250 or Ram 1500.

Q: How many times can it jump-start a car on one charge?
A: It can typically jump-start a car 15–20 times on a full charge, depending on engine size and temperature.

Q: Does it work in freezing temperatures?
A: Yes, it operates reliably from -4°F to 131°F. The BOOST mode helps start engines in extreme cold.

Q: Can I charge my laptop with it?
A: Yes, the 65W USB-C port supports laptops like MacBook Air, Dell XPS, and HP Spectre.

Q: Is the 65W charger included?
A: No, you’ll need a compatible 65W PD charger for fastest recharge. The included cables work with existing chargers.

Q: How long does the battery last when not in use?
A: The battery retains charge for up to 12 months. It’s recommended to recharge every 3–6 months.

Q: Is it safe to leave in the car?
A: Yes, but avoid extreme heat (above 140°F) for prolonged periods. Store in a cool, dry place when possible.

Q: Can I use it to charge my phone while jump-starting?
A: No, the jump-start function and charging cannot be used simultaneously for safety reasons.

Q: What’s the warranty?
A: 18 months from the date of purchase, covering defects in materials and workmanship.

Q: Is it TSA-approved for flights?
A: Yes, it’s allowed in carry-on luggage. Check with your airline for specific rules.
